Предисловие
Contents
[
Hide
]
Aspose.Cells for Reporting Services в основном содержит два компонента: Aspose.Cells.Report.Designer и Aspose.Cells.Renderer для Reporting Services. Первый используется для проектирования отчетов напрямую в Microsoft Excel, а второй отвечает за отображение RDL-отчета в Microsoft Excel.
Проектирование отчета с помощью конструктора отчетов
Основные шаги проектирования отчета с использованием Aspose.Cells.Report.Designer:
- Создание источников данных и запросов. Microsoft Query интегрирован с Aspose.Cells.Report.Designer и используется в качестве графического инструмента для создания источников данных и запросов. Пользователи также могут использовать существующий файл RDL, в котором источники данных и запросы доступны для операций.
- Сопоставление параметров. Если запросы SQL включают параметры, пользователи должны создать параметры отчета и сопоставить SQL-параметры с параметрами отчета. В Aspose.Cells.Report.Designer вы можете указать допустимые значения для параметра отчета.
- Проектирование содержимого, стилей и форматов шаблона отчета Microsoft Excel.
Шаблон отчета Aspose.Cells может содержать любое количество следующих типов элементов отчета:
- Таблица
- Сводная таблица
- Диаграмма
- Текстовое поле
- Матрица Обычно запрос (то есть DataSet) используется в качестве источника данных для элемента отчета. Вы также можете использовать параметры Reporting Services, формулы и глобальные переменные как источник данных для некоторых типов элементов отчета. Стили и форматы элементов отчета указываются просто установкой стилей и форматов ячеек, составляющих элементы отчета.
- Опубликовать отчет. После выполнения вышеуказанных шагов отчет готов к публикации. Пользователи могут указать каталог, в который будет опубликован отчет. При необходимости вы можете назначить общий источник данных на сервере отчетов в качестве источника данных для отчета.
- Предварительный просмотр отчета. При выборе отчета для предварительного просмотра на сервере отчетов вам будет предложено указать, в какой формат файла экспортировать его (например, бинарный формат XLS Microsoft Excel 97-2003, SpreadsheetML или формат XLSX Microsoft Excel 2007), а также любые входные параметры отчета, созданные во время разработки отчета. После этого отчет будет заполнен данными, предоставленными службами отчетов.